Thrall
Thrashes The Fair
By Rupert X Pellett
Ohio County Fairs Motocross Championship Series - Round 5
Marion County Fairgrounds
Marion, OH
Jun 27
Former
pro-mechanic Pat Thrall, of Columbus, Ohio decided it was time for
some wins in this fair - race
series, so here, in Marion, at round five, Thrall went off on the
vet classes, scattering the old
timers as he flung his number 61 Yamaha around the jumpy circuit
in record time. A sometimes competitor in the pro classes as well,
Thrall opted to solely compete
in the vet classes here in Marion and romped to wins in the
25 plus and 30 plus classes, putting
on a mild riding clinic in the process. " I've been practicing
a lot at Brett Heskett's sand track in Newark " , explained
Thrall, " and I've picked
up the pace a bit. Still need to work on my starts though. I need
to talk to my buddy Jeromy
Buehl and see what's what." The pro classes would see a bunch
of great racing, but it was
Tony " The Tiger" Robinson winning most of the cash -
Robinson stole the show in the 125
money class and finished a strong second behind winner
Jared Grabiel in 250 Pro. Fast kid Dylan Walker was impressive
too, at this round five of the
Ohio County Fairs Motocross Championship Series - he ran away
with the 85 (7-11) class and the 85 extra race, as well.
